I want to create a Kotlin script that can represen...
# announcements
w
I want to create a Kotlin script that can represent current files structure in JSON or XML code but with some conditions. • I want to my representation to not mention middle empty directories. • I want to only list files ended with 
Activity.*
For example: for this structure
Copy code
my_project
 -> feature1
  -> src
   -> java
    -> com
     -> directory
      -> MainActivity.kt
      -> MainFragment.kt
 -> feature2
  -> src
   -> java
    -> com
     -> directory
      -> Feature2Activity.kt
      -> Feature2Fragment.kt
Should generate
Copy code
{
  "my_project": {
    "feature1": {
      "directory": [
        "MainActivity"
      ]
    },
    "feature2": {
      "directory": [
        "Feature2Activity"
      ]
    }
  }
}
I don't have decencies to any Android modules, just Kotlin maybe using FileTreeWalk